The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of John Loosemore, born in 1819 in Devon, consisted of 4 members. John was the head of the household, married to Mary Loosemore, born in 1826 in -. They had 1 child; William H, born 1850 in Devon, England.
During the period, also present in the household was John's Servant, Lucy Crosscombe, born in 1868 in King's Nympton, Devon, England.
